-
[Pymysql] 파이썬으로 Database 연결하는법언어/Python 2023. 1. 4. 15:09
조회하는 테이블내용
#1. install + import pymysql #터미널에서 pip install pymysql import pymysql if __name__ == '__main__': conn = "" cursor = "" #1. MariaDB연결 : pymysql.connect conn = pymysql.connect(host='localhost', port=포트번호, user='root', password='비밀번호', db='intern', charset='utf8') #2. 커서생성 cursor = conn.cursor() #3. sql문 입력 sql = "select INTN_NAME from intern_info" #4. sql문 실행 cursor.execute(sql) #5. 데이터 fetch results = cursor.fetchall() print(results) #6. DB commit conn.commit() #7. DB close conn.close()
결과 : print(fetch데이터)를 하면 튜플로 반환된다.
(('최다윤',), ('김영서',), ('백송이',), ('박지원',), ('김영서',), ('백송이',), ('박지원',), ('김영서',), ('백송이',), ('박지원',), ('김영서',), ('백송이',), ('박지원',))
참조 : http://pythonstudy.xyz/python/article/202-MySQL-%EC%BF%BC%EB%A6%AC
예제로 배우는 파이썬 프로그래밍 - MySQL 쿼리
1. MySQL DB 모듈 Python에서 MySQL 데이타베이스를 사용하기 위해 우선 Python DB API 표준을 따르는 MySQL DB 모듈을 다운받아 설치한다. MySQL DB 를 지원하는 Python 모듈은 여러 가지가 있는데, 여기서는 PyMyS
pythonstudy.xyz
반응형'언어 > Python' 카테고리의 다른 글
[파이참] 프로젝트 경로가 변경되어 나는 오류 : Error running 'prac': Cannot run program : CreateProcess error=2, 지정된 파일을 찾을 수 없습니다 (0) 2023.01.05 [pymysql]Fetchall로 불러온 값 dict로 출력하기 (0) 2023.01.04 [FastAPI]client-server 데이터 주고받기 && 422 에러 (0) 2022.12.28 Fast API, client-server 데이터 받기 (0) 2022.12.28 [JSON/Python]TypeError: Object of type datetime is not JSON serializable (0) 2022.12.27